INFORMAL RESOLUTION OF THE BOARD OF
COUNTY COMMISSIONERS OF PITKIN COUNTY,
COLORADO AUTHORIZING THE COUNTY
MANAGER’S OFFICE TO SUBMIT A GRANT
APPLICATION TO THE DEPARTMENT OF LOCAL
AFFAIRS’ ENERGY AND MINERAL IMPACT
ASSISTANCE FUND CLIMATE RESILIENCE
CHALLENGE FOR THE DEVELOPMENT OF AN
UPDATED CLIMATE ACTION PLAN
RESOLUTION NO. 054, 2023
RECITALS
WHEREAS, Pursuant to Section 2.8.4 (Actions) of the Pitkin County Home Rule Charter
(“HRC”), all matters not required to be acted upon by ordinance or formal resolution may
be acted upon by informal resolution, and;
WHEREAS, Pitkin County’s current Climate Action Plan was last adopted in 2017.
WHEREAS, in 2021, Pitkin County adopted Climate Action Goals pursuant to Resolution
No. 042-2021 to 1) reduce annual greenhouse gas emissions by 90% from 2019 levels by
2050; 2) adapt infrastructure, land-use, and regional and environmental resources for the
impacts of Climate Change, and; 3) equitably involve citizens and stakeholders of all socio-
economic and racial backgrounds in outreach and education programs to determine and
provide best practices for Climate Change adaptation and mitigation, and;
WHEREAS, the State of Colorado's Department of Local Affairs established the Climate
Resilience Challenge which set aside $20M over the next three fiscal years to encourage
and support local governments to promote and integrate climate resilience projects that
capture multiple objectives across climate adaptation and climate mitigation solutions,
holistically address the most high-risk vulnerabilities for the region while advancing
inclusion, diversity, equity, and accessibility (IDEA).
WHEREAS, Climate Resiliency Challenge provides funding support to local governments
for the planning and implementation to move forward cutting edge climate work, and;
WHEREAS, Pitkin County is requesting $117,000 in funding from the Department of Local
Affairs Climate Resilience Challenge, with Pitkin County contributing $13,000 in local
match to fund the development of an updated Integrated Climate Action Plan that identifies
bold climate initiatives to meet the County’s climate goals.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Board of County Commissioners of
Pitkin County, Colorado that it hereby adopts an Informal Resolution of the Board of
County Commissioners of Pitkin County, Colorado Authorizing the County Manager’s
Office to Submit a Grant Application to the Department of Local Affairs’ Energy and
Mineral Impact Assistance Fund Climate Resilience Challenge for the Development of an
Updated Climate Action Plan (attached hereto as Exhibit A) and authorizes the Chair to
sign the Resolution and upon the satisfaction of the County Attorney as to form, execute
any other associated documents necessary to complete this matter.
INTRODUCED, READ AND ADOPTED ON THE 26TH DAY OF JULY 2023.
